Evaluating Top Portable Power Station Brands

When it comes to portable power station brands, there are few key players that stand out in the market. Let’s delve into evaluating some top contenders in this competitive landscape, using a variety of factors, such as power output, battery capacity, price, and user reviews.

Goal Zero, specifically their Yeti series, has proven to be a favorite among users. These models shine with high power output and impressive battery capacities, ranging from 200 to 3000 watt-hours. The downside? They’re a bit on the pricey side, but you’re paying for quality here.

Then, there’s Jackery, a brand praised for its excellent customer service. Most loved in their lineup is the Explorer series. It’s not just about power with these models; they boast of user-friendly designs and portable sizes too. Plus, they’re more affordable than Goal Zero units, making them a favored budget pick.

But let’s not forget EcoFlow! This brand’s River series is, without a doubt, a powerful contender. Standout points include high-speed charging, solar panel compatibility, and versatility in power output. The diversity of their model range allows customers to select the best fit according to their individual needs.

Additional high ranking brands include Anker and NexPow. Anker is loved for their sleek designs and high-speed charging, while NexPow is a budget-friendly brand not to be underestimated.

Here’s a quick look at these brands in comparison:

Brand Power Output (Watt) Battery Capacity (Watt-Hours) Price Range
Goal Zero 200 – 3000 200 – 3000 $$$
Jackery 160 – 1000 167 – 1002 $$
EcoFlow 200 – 1800 288 – 1260 $$$
Anker 60 – 770 213 – 777 $$
NexPow 178 – 480 150 – 480 $

Key Features to Consider for the Best Portable Power Station

There’s a lot to consider when you’re in the market for the best portable power station. It’s not all about power output and price, what’s inside matters too, so let’s break down some key features to look for.

Battery Capacity: The battery capacity of a power station is critical. It determines how long it can provide power for. Measured in watt-hours (Wh), it indicates how much energy it can store. Basically, a larger number means the power station can run for a longer time.

Weight and Size: Let’s face it, if it’s not portable, it defeats the purpose. A good portable power station should be lightweight and compact, easing movement between locations. However, there’s often a trade-off between portability and power output.

Output Ports: Another important characteristic is the types and number of outlets (also called ports) provided by the power station. Portable power stations come equipped with a variety of ports like USB, AC outlets, 12V DC ports, and more.

Here’s a basic comparison of the general port types:

Port Type Typical Use
USB Charging small devices like phones and tablets.
AC Outlet Power tools, kitchen appliances, laptops.
12V DC Port Camping lights, coolers and air pumps.

Charging Options: How can the power station itself be recharged? Check for multiple options such as solar, car charger or AC wall outlet to ensure flexibility.

Solar Compatibility: If you’re planning on spending long periods off the grid, you’ll want a power station that’s solar panel compatible. This allows for renewable energy usage and continuous power supply in sunny conditions.

Safety Features: Lastly, don’t overlook the safety features. These include short-circuit protection, overheat protection, and overcharge protection – vital characteristics to help ensure the longevity of the power station and your devices.
